The Agiou Antoniou Chapel is situated in the village of Peristerona in the Nicosia district. More specifically the chapel is located west of the Agion Varnava and Ilarionos Church , which is the main church of the village.

According to tradition the chapel was built over the remains of an older chapel which was possibly destroyed due to the passing of time.

Architecturally the chapel is made up of one room, it has an arched roof and it dated to the 18th century. Its exterior is made of stone and it has been maintained with the assistance of the community. There is a wooden bell tower to the southwest of the chapel.

The interior of the church is simple and plat without the existence of hagiographies. The wooden templo was recently restored in the year 2003. The icons which surround it are also new.

The chapel operates on the 17th of January, which is when Agios Antonios is celebrated, as well as for all of January.
